However, it is much more efficient to go clean a fleet of trucks, cars, buses, aircraft, than it is to take each of those individual items to a facility, such as a truck wash, bus wash, car wash, or aircraft wash rack individually.
Plus, most auto detailers and mobile car washers are very conservative with their water supply, because water weighs a lot and it takes too much time to keep refilling.
With the extra weight it means more fuel used, and more trips increases those fuel costs which by the end of the week add up to a substantial amount of cost.
I know one mobile car wash entrepreneur, whose units are ultra-efficient with water supply, 10x's less water used, thus, less to reclaim too.
